Q: What changed in the Driftkey password reset revamp?

A: The old email-link flow is gone. Resets now issue a short-lived, single-use code validated server-side; no token ever appears in a URL. Rate limiting moved from the gateway into the reset service itself, so don't re-add gateway rules. Legacy reset endpoints return 410 and will be deleted next quarter. Architecture notes, sequence diagrams, and the deprecation schedule are on the internal page below.

dashboard of tahop-fahof = https://harbor.tolvaqnet.example/secrets/merge_requests/board/issue/merge_requests/pipeline/secrets/ecb30ed86a55c001a77f6cb9

Hi Priya,

Welcome to the ChipTrack on-call rotation! Quick heads-up before race weekend: the timing-chip readers at the Ferndale Marathon occasionally drop sync when the mesh network hiccups, and you'll get paged for it. Usually a reader restart fixes things in under a minute. Everything you need — escalation steps, reader IDs, restart commands — lives on the runbook page here.

dashboard of tawef-hagug = https://superset.norvadyn.local/display/projects/build/ticket/build/spaces/ticket/1e989f0e6c200d20fc4ae06b

Plugin authors: the Farrow CI fleet enforces a 250ms clock-skew tolerance between build agents. If your plugin signs timestamps, sync against the fleet's internal time service rather than the host clock. Set `FARROW_TIME_SOURCE=fleet` in your plugin's env file, then add the time-service access token on the following line:

vault entry, yahif-yajep: COURIER_KEY29=b802bdf8034096b65a51c6ba5abe2

Ticket: Staging env misconfigured for Siftgate bloom filter

The bloom layer in front of the Pellet KV store is rejecting all lookups in staging because the env file was copied from the dev template without credentials. False-positive tuning values are fine; only the auth line is missing. To unblock the weekly demo, the Pellet admission secret must be set on the following line.

env line for yaguf-fajop: LEDGER_TOKEN13=fb08984397349